2008-10-24 54 views
2

有沒有辦法在Visual Studio中創建一個空白的解決方案或某種類型的基於文件的項目解決方案,以便我可以指向一個根文件夾,並讓該根中的所有子文件夾和文件顯示出來在我的解決方案瀏覽器我意識到我可以創建一個空白的解決方案,然後通過添加>現有項目手動添加單個項目,但是,這不會保持文件夾結構不變,而且,如果我有很多文件夾/文件,則需要花費很長時間。Visual Studio解決方案只是指向一個文件夾,並顯示解決方案資源管理器中的所有子文件夾和文件?

+0

將文件添加到一個解決方案或項目? – StingyJack 2008-10-24 15:25:04

+0

基本上,我想要的是隻有'Windows資源管理器'作爲我的解決方案資源管理器。這樣我可以瀏覽文件夾樹,選擇一個文件進行編輯。我不想創建一個Web應用程序或其他應用程序,然後顯示所有文件,並將它們包含在項目中。我不需要一個項目,只需要編輯。 – EvilSyn 2008-10-24 15:31:57

回答

4

您也可以創建空白解決方案,然後單擊解決方案資源管理器頂部的第二個從右邊的圖標(它看起來像是三個文件,其中一個「裁剪」)。一旦您單擊該按鈕以顯示解決方案目錄中不在項目中的文件,您可以選擇所有文件(通過Shift-單擊),然後右鍵單擊您的選擇並選擇「包含在項目中」。

另請注意,您可以在「添加現有...」文件窗口中使用shift或control-click選擇多個文件。

1

您必須在解決方案中創建Visual Studio項目才能添加文件並保留其文件夾結構。要添加的文件必須位於項目的主文件夾下。我建議添加一個「C#空項目」(解決方案資源管理器:解決方案>添加>新項目...> Visual C#> Windows>空項目)。之後,您可以按照SoloBold所述進行操作,以顯示項目文件夾中的文件。右鍵單擊源文件的最頂層文件夾,選擇「Include In Project」,包含所有文件的整個文件夾結構將被添加。這可能需要一些時間,具體取決於文件/子文件夾的數量。

參見:Answer to similar question, with screenshot

相關問題